Reinforced recycled red brick aggregate, preparation method thereof, mortar and preparation method thereof
The invention discloses a reinforced recycled red brick aggregate and a preparation method thereof, and mortar and a preparation method thereof, and relates to the technical field of building materials, and the method comprises the following steps: calcining the recycled red brick aggregate at 400-600 DEG C, after calcining, carrying out ball milling, sieving, and separating to obtain a first recycled coarse aggregate and a first recycled fine aggregate; soaking the first recycled coarse aggregate in a weak acid solution for 8-10 hours, taking out the first recycled coarse aggregate, sieving the first recycled coarse aggregate, and separating the first recycled coarse aggregate into a second recycled coarse aggregate and a second recycled fine aggregate; soaking the second recycled fine aggregate in a polyethyleneimine solution for 4-6 hours to obtain third recycled fine aggregate and soaking waste liquid; performing precipitation treatment on the soaking waste liquid to obtain supernatant liquid and precipitate, and separating the precipitate to obtain fourth regenerated fine aggregate; and drying the first recycled fine aggregate, the third recycled fine aggregate and the fourth recycled fine aggregate in the air, and sieving to obtain the reinforced recycled red brick aggregate with the particle size of 0.15-4.75 mm. The strength of the recycled red brick aggregate can be improved.
